				968 suspension
			 
			
			What suspension parts from rollover Porsche 968 I can use in Superbug? Whishbones, hubs, brakes, trailing arms? What else?

			The 968, suspension and brakes, are nothing more than 951 parts. When looking for parts and information just keep this in mind... 968 = early 944 Turbo 968 S = late 944 Turbo There were no new or special suspension or brake parts made for the 968, it's all 944 Turbo stuff. |
